Leaving Jefferson High in Seattle to spend her senior year going to school in Manchester, England while her teacher-father exchanges jobs with an Englishmn, has two strong appeals for Kathy. One is the thrill of living in England for a year, and the other is the relief of getting away from Jefferson where she is rather out of step with her contemporaries.
